Home
last modified time | relevance | path

Searched refs:di_nlink (Results 1 – 20 of 20) sorted by relevance

/freebsd/sbin/fsck_ffs/
H A Ddir.c459 if (DIP(dp, di_nlink) == lcnt) { in adjust()
494 DIP(dp, di_nlink), DIP(dp, di_nlink) - lcnt); in adjust()
505 DIP_SET(dp, di_nlink, DIP(dp, di_nlink) - lcnt); in adjust()
675 DIP_SET(dp, di_nlink, DIP(dp, di_nlink) + 1); in linkup()
940 DIP_SET(dp, di_nlink, 2); in allocdir()
948 inoinfo(ino)->ino_linkcnt = DIP(dp, di_nlink); in allocdir()
971 inoinfo(ino)->ino_linkcnt = DIP(dp, di_nlink); in allocdir()
[all...]
H A Dsuj.c538 if (DIP(dp, di_nlink) == 0 || DIP(dp, di_mode) == 0) { in blk_isat()
1043 (uintmax_t)ino, DIP(dp, di_nlink), DIP(dp, di_mode)); in ino_reclaim()
1048 DIP_SET(dp, di_nlink, 0); in ino_reclaim()
1078 nlink = DIP(dp, di_nlink); in ino_decr()
1097 DIP_SET(dp, di_nlink, nlink); in ino_decr()
1166 (uintmax_t)ino, (uintmax_t)nlink, DIP(dp, di_nlink)); in ino_adjust()
1169 (uintmax_t)ino, (uintmax_t)nlink, DIP(dp, di_nlink), in ino_adjust()
1198 if (DIP(dp, di_nlink) == nlink) { in ino_adjust()
1205 DIP_SET(dp, di_nlink, nlink); in ino_adjust()
1664 if (DIP(dp, di_nlink) == 0) { in ino_unlinked()
[all …]
H A Dgjournal.c124 if (dp->dp2.di_nlink > 0) { in gjournal_check()
H A Dpass1.c381 inoinfo(inumber)->ino_linkcnt = DIP(dp, di_nlink); in checkinode()
385 } else if (DIP(dp, di_nlink) == 0) { in checkinode()
392 } else if (DIP(dp, di_nlink) <= 0) in checkinode()
H A Dpass2.c533 inoinfo(dirp->d_ino)->ino_linkcnt = DIP(dp, di_nlink); in pass2check()
H A Dinode.c1289 cmd.size = -DIP(dp, di_nlink); in clri()
/freebsd/sys/ufs/ufs/
H A Ddinode.h127 uint16_t di_nlink; /* 2: File link count. */ member
182 uint16_t di_nlink; /* 2: File link count. */ member
/freebsd/usr.sbin/makefs/ffs/
H A Dufs_inode.h61 #define i_ffs1_nlink i_din.dp1.di_nlink
82 #define i_ffs2_nlink i_din.dp2.di_nlink
H A Dffs_bswap.c125 n->di_nlink = bswap16(o->di_nlink); in ffs_dinode1_swap()
146 n->di_nlink = bswap16(o->di_nlink); in ffs_dinode2_swap()
/freebsd/sbin/fsdb/
H A Dfsdb.c416 DIP_SET(curinode, di_nlink, DIP(curinode, di_nlink) + 1); in CMDFUNCSTART()
418 (uintmax_t)curinum, DIP(curinode, di_nlink)); in CMDFUNCSTART()
427 DIP_SET(curinode, di_nlink, DIP(curinode, di_nlink) - 1); in CMDFUNCSTART()
429 (uintmax_t)curinum, DIP(curinode, di_nlink)); in CMDFUNCSTART()
1108 DIP_SET(curinode, di_nlink, lcnt); in CMDFUNCSTART()
H A Dfsdbutil.c188 printf("LINKCNT=%d FLAGS=%#x BLKCNT=%jx GEN=%jx\n", DIP(dp, di_nlink), in printstat()
/freebsd/sbin/ffsinfo/
H A Dffsinfo.c341 if (dp.dp1->di_nlink == 0) { in dump_whole_ufs1_inode()
495 if (dp.dp2->di_nlink == 0) { in dump_whole_ufs2_inode()
/freebsd/sbin/newfs/
H A Dmkfs.c923 node.dp1.di_nlink = entries; in fsinit()
937 node.dp1.di_nlink = SNAPLINKCNT; in fsinit()
960 node.dp2.di_nlink = entries; in fsinit()
974 node.dp2.di_nlink = SNAPLINKCNT; in fsinit()
/freebsd/sbin/growfs/
H A Ddebug.c676 fprintf(dbg_log, "nlink int16_t 0x%04x\n", ino->di_nlink); in dbg_dump_ufs1_ino()
743 fprintf(dbg_log, "nlink int16_t 0x%04x\n", ino->di_nlink); in dbg_dump_ufs2_ino()
/freebsd/sbin/tunefs/
H A Dtunefs.c980 dp.dp1->di_nlink = 1; in journal_alloc()
990 dp.dp2->di_nlink = 1; in journal_alloc()
/freebsd/sys/ufs/ffs/
H A Dffs_vfsops.c199 ip->i_nlink = dip1->di_nlink; in ffs_load_inode()
200 ip->i_effnlink = dip1->di_nlink; in ffs_load_inode()
221 ip->i_nlink = dip2->di_nlink; in ffs_load_inode()
222 ip->i_effnlink = dip2->di_nlink; in ffs_load_inode()
H A Dffs_softdep.c10458 inodedep->id_savednlink = dp->di_nlink; in initiate_write_inodeblock_ufs1()
10467 dp->di_nlink = inoref->if_nlink; in initiate_write_inodeblock_ufs1()
10631 inodedep->id_savednlink = dp->di_nlink; in initiate_write_inodeblock_ufs2()
10641 dp->di_nlink = inoref->if_nlink; in initiate_write_inodeblock_ufs2()
11829 if (dp1->di_nlink != inodedep->id_savednlink) { in handle_written_inodeblock()
11830 dp1->di_nlink = inodedep->id_savednlink; in handle_written_inodeblock()
11838 if (dp2->di_nlink != inodedep->id_savednlink) { in handle_written_inodeblock()
11839 dp2->di_nlink = inodedep->id_savednlink; in handle_written_inodeblock()
/freebsd/usr.sbin/makefs/
H A Dffs.c686 dinp->di_nlink = cur->inode->nlink; in ffs_build_dinode1()
734 dinp->di_nlink = cur->inode->nlink; in ffs_build_dinode2()
H A Dffs.c686 dinp->di_nlink = cur->inode->nlink; in ffs_build_dinode1()
734 dinp->di_nlink = cur->inode->nlink; in ffs_build_dinode2()
/freebsd/stand/libsa/
H A Dext2fs.c269 uint16_t di_nlink; /* link count */ member